Originally Posted by TVPostSound
Did they remove the R/T from the E/T?
If not, then you would have been 13 dead with a good R/T!!
Reaction time is never included in the ET, at least not at any track that I've ever raced.

His reaction time is respectable, assuming that he wasn't on a Pro Tree.
